Yes there is. Before your 1st official attempt I would suggest logging into LSAC and they have a section where you can attempt a PT. The PT interface LSAC has is basically the exact same as what you see on test day. 7sage’s layout is very similar but what you see within LSACs PT format is exactly what you see on test day so there is no shocks.
